2.2. Протоколы распределения ключей
2.2.1.
Основные понятия и определенияПротокол распределения ключей (key establishment protocol) - это криптографический протокол, в процессе выполнения которого общий секрет становится доступен двум или более сторонам для по-следующего использования в криптографических целях.
Протоколы распределения ключей подразделяются на два класса: протоколы транспортировки ключей и обмена ключами.
Протоколы транспортировки ключей (key transport) - это про-токолы распределения ключей, в которых один участник создает или другим образом приобретает секрет и безопасным образом передает его другим участникам.
Протоколы обмена ключами (key agreement, key exchange) — это протоколы распределения ключей, в которых общий секрет выраба- тывается двумя или более участниками как функция от информации, вносимой каждым из них (или ассоциированной с ними) таким образом, что (в идеале) никакая другая сторона не может предопределить их общий секрет.
Выделяют две дополнительные формы протоколов распределения ключей. Говорят, что протокол осуществляет обновление ключей (key update), если в протоколе вырабатывается совершенно новый ключ, не зависящий от ключей, выработанных в прошлых сеансах выполнения протокола. Протокол выполняет выработку производ-ных ключей (key derivationJ, если новый ключ «выводится» из уже существующих у участников криптосистемы.
Протоколы распределения ключей можно классифицировать и по другому признаку.
Протоколы с предраспределенньши ключами (key pre-distribu-tion) - протоколы распределения ключей, в которых результирующие ключи полностью определены априори начальным ключевым материалом. К особому виду таких протоколов можно отнести схемы разделения секрета.
Протоколы динамического распределения ключей (dynamic key establishment) - протоколы распределения ключей, в которых ключи, вырабатываемые фиксированной парой (или группой) участников различны в разных сеансах протокола.
Этот процесс называют также распределением сеансовых ключей.Протоколы распределения ключей можно также классифицировать по признаку использования в них симметричных либо асиммет-ричных криптосхем.
Классификация рассматриваемых далее протоколов распределения ключей по перечисленным выше признакам показана в табл. 2.1.
Таблица 2.1. Классификация протоколов распределения ключей Классы протоколов Протоколы распределения ключей Транспортировка ключей Обмен ключами Протоколы, основанные на симметричных криптосхемах Needham - Schroeder, Otway - Rees, Kerbe- ros, трехэтапный протокол Шамира Шарады Меркле Схема Бпома Схемы разде-ления секрета
Классы протоколов Протоколы распределения ключей Транспортировка ключей Обмен ключами Протоколы, основанные на асимметричных крип- тосхемах Needham - Schroeder, Х.509, Beller-Yacobi, SSL Diffie- Hellman, ElGamal, MTl, STS, Gunther Схемы разде-ления секрета Динамическое распределение ключей Протоколы с предраспределен- ными ключами
Протоколы распределения ключей могут строиться как без участия «третьей стороны», так и с ее участием. Доверенная «третья сторона» может выполнять различные функции: сервер аутентификации, центр распределения ключей, центр трансляции ключей, удо-стоверяющий центр и др.
Еще по теме 2.2. Протоколы распределения ключей:
- 2.2.3. Протоколы распределения ключей, основанные
- 2.2.4. Протоколы распределения ключей, основанные на асимметричных криптосхемах
- 2.2.6. Методы анализа протоколов распределения ключей
- 2.2.2. Свойства протоколов распределения ключей
- 2.1.6. Метод сертификации открытых ключей.Инфраструктура открытых ключей
- § 85. Протокол судового засідання. Порядок складання і зміст. Зауваження до протоколу.
- § 63. Протокол судового засідання. Порядок складання і зміст. Зауваження до протоколу.
- Распределение Пирсона (или “хи”-квадрат распределение)
- 2.1.2. Жизненный цикл криптографических ключей
- 2.1.5. Методы распространения открытых ключей
- 5.4. Законы распределения отдельных компонент, входящих в систему. Условные законы распределения.
- 6.3. Закон распределения суммы двух случайных величин. Композиция законов распределения.
- 3.1. Команды получения распределений и описательных статистик3.1.1. FREQUENCIES - получение одномерных распределений переменных
- Приложение Федеральный закон от 25 октября 1999 г. N 190-ФЗ «О ратификации Европейской конвенции о выдаче. Дополнительного протокола и Второго дополнительного протокола к ней» (с сокращениями) Принят Государственной Думой 1 октября 1999 года. Одобрен Советом федерации 13 октября 1999 года.
- Протокол рукопожатия (SSL HP)
- 1.2. Основы теории криптографических протоколов
- 1.4. Протоколы аутентификации